Real-World Wins: When Storage Meets Kroner

Take the case of Oslo Maritime Manufacturing AS. By installing modular lithium-ion storage:

  • Peak demand charges dropped 40% (that’s 2.8 million kroner/year saved)
  • Backup power reliability reached 99.999% – fewer outages than lutefisk dinners canceled
  • Carbon footprint shrunk by 18% in 6 months
